Things To Consider When Buying An Electric Bike


Are you thinking of buying an electric bike for yourself? Electric bikes have become extremely popular in recent years, and for many good reasons. They offer an effortless way to travel and exercise while being environmentally friendly. But with so many options available, it can be overwhelming to choose the right electric bike for you. In this guide, we’ll provide some tips on what to look for when buying an electric bike for adults.

1. Assess Your Riding Requirements


The first step in buying an electric bike is to determine your riding needs. Think about how you plan to use your electric bike, whether it’s for commuting to work, riding on off-road trails, or leisurely rides around town. This will help you narrow down your options and choose an electric bike that meets your specific requirements.

2. Select Your Motor


The engine is one of the most critical components of an electric bike. It affects how fast you can go and how far you can travel on a single charge. The two most common types motors for electric bikes are hub motors and mid-drive motors.

Hub motors are located in the wheels and deliver power to the bike’s rear wheel. They are easy to maintain and less expensive than mid-drive motors. However, they can add weight to the bike and make it more difficult to handle.

Mid-drive motors, on the other hand, are found close to the bike’s bottom bracket and provide power to the chain. They are more efficient and provide better torque. However, they can be more expensive and require more maintenance.

3. Evaluate the Battery


The battery is another important component to consider when buying an electric bike. The battery capacity determines the range of the bike. Most electric bikes come with lithium-ion batteries, which are rechargeable and long-lasting. The capacity of the battery is measured in watt-hours (Wh). The higher the watt-hours, the further you can travel on a single charge. For daily purposes, a battery with a capacity of at least 400Wh is recommended.

4. Consider the Weight


The weight of the electric bike is an important factor to consider. Electric bikes are known to be weigh more than traditional bikes due to the added weight of the motor and battery. However, the weight can differ based on the bike type and components.

If you plan on using your electric bike for commuting or leisurely rides, a lighter bike may be more suitable. However, if you plan on using your electric bike for off-road trails or mountain biking, a heavier bike may be more stable.

5. Evaluate the Bike’s Features


When choosing an electric bike, consider the features that are essential to you. Some popular features include suspension for off-road riding, fenders and lights for commuting, and adjustable seats and handlebars for personalized comfort.

6. Take the Bike for a Test Ride


Before making a purchase, it’s important to test ride the electric bike. This will help you experience the bike's performance and handling and ensure that it meets your needs.

7. Consider the Price


Electric bikes can vary in price from relatively inexpensive to bikes that cost several thousands of dollars. Assess your budget and prioritize the features that matter to you. While a higher price may mean better quality and features, there are also affordable electric bikes available with good features.

8. Read Reviews and Conduct Research


Reading reviews and conducting research is an important step in buying an electric bike. Seek reviews from reliable sources and factor in the experiences of other riders. Additionally, research the brand and warranty coverage to ensure that you are getting a reliable and durable electric bike.

9. Consider Maintenance and Repair


Maintenance and repair requirements should be evaluated when purchasing an electric bike. Consider the availability of replacement parts and the cost of repairs.
